Who owns objects? : the ethics and politics of collecting cultural artefacts : proceedings of the first St. Cross-All Souls seminar series and workshop, Oxford, October-December 2004 /

Who owns cultural objects? And, who has the right to own them? This book is the outcome of a series of lectures and workshops held in Oxford in between October and December 2004. It aims to provoke thought and debate on this topical and sensitive subject area.
